Disappearing Crystals
Source Institutions
Learners experiment with water gel crystals, or sodium polyacrylate crystals, which absorb hundreds of times their weight in water. When in pure water, the water gel crystals cannot be seen.

Fireworks!
Source Institutions
In this chemistry lab activity, learners model the colors of fireworks by burning metallic solutions in a flame and observing the different colors produced.

How Greenhouse Gases Absorb Heat
Source Institutions
Learners observe two model atmospheres -- one with normal atmospheric composition and another with an elevated concentration of carbon dioxide.
